Given z1 = 2 +StartRoot 3 EndRoot i and z2 = 1 – StartRoot 3 EndRoot i, what is the sum of z1 and z2?
Fofino [41]

Answer:

z1 + z2 = 3

Step-by-step explanation:

Since we are given z1 = 2 + √(3)i and z2 = 1 – √(3)i. The sum of z1 + z2 would be:

(2 + √(3)i) + (1 – √(3)i) = 2 + √(3)i + 1 – √(3)i = 2 + 1 + √(3)i – √(3)i = 3

Hence, z1 + z2 = 3.
